Elizabeth Ann Wright

BirthJan 1872 - St George in the East
Death1913 - Whitechapel, London, Middlesex, England
MotherEllen Sarah Benard HEATHER
FatherJames "Jim" Wright

Born in St George in the East on Jan 1872 to James "Jim" Wright and Ellen Sarah Benard HEATHER. Elizabeth Ann Wright married Henry Fenn and had 12 children. She passed away on 1913 in Whitechapel, London, Middlesex, England.
